CI failure on the tailgrub log-tailing CLI traces to a stale fixture: the sample log rotated mid-test, so the follow assertion read zero lines. Fix pins the fixture to a static snapshot from the Verlow archive. Reviewer should confirm the rotation test still exercises the real path. All checks pass against the build noted below.

build token for tahop-fafof: htk14_2d55df8101eccc

Subject: Insurance Renewal — quick note

Hi all — our coverage through Pellbright Mutual renews next month. Premiums are up about 9%, mostly tied to the expanded Norcliff warehouse. We're negotiating a bundled rate and expect resolution within two weeks. Sales leads, no action yet, just awareness. Relevant planning context sits in the confidential note below.

board note of kajeg-bahof: Holdorix Works plans to lower the Briius list price by 11.6 percent in September. The pricing group signed off on a budget of $499.9 million for Project Holdor. The renewal with Fraokix Group closes at $129.5 million a year, 50.2 percent above the last contract. Project Tameth slips by one quarter because of the tooling delay.

When reviewing changes to the profiling hooks, note that the Gravimeter agent samples allocator state on a fixed interval rather than per-kernel, so short-lived spikes may be invisible unless the interval is lowered. Lowering it below 50ms has caused measurable latency regressions on the Calderwood nodes, so any change to sampling cadence needs a benchmark run attached to the review. Verify also that snapshot retention does not exceed local disk headroom. The agent ships with the following default configuration:

config for kafof-bawef:
holath:
  log_level: debug
  metrics_host: metrics.holath.qorvelsys.internal
  pin: 2191
  pool_size: 32

Subject: DR drill tomorrow — FeedCheckly validator

Hey support crew,

Quick heads-up: tomorrow morning we're running the quarterly disaster-recovery drill on FeedCheckly, our podcast feed validator. We'll fail over to the Harlow Ridge cluster around 09:30, so expect validation jobs to pause for ten minutes or so. If anything weird comes up, log it in the drill channel rather than paging anyone. To restore the standby admin account during the drill, use the passphrase below.

unlock words, hahip-yagef: zorok-novmir-zorix-silax